Holland Aquatic Center Overview

Holland Aquatic Center is part of a larger community health complex with exercise facilities and more.

But the aquatic center itself is a big draw for families in Holland, MI and beyond.

Holland Aquatic Center

The aquatic center has an *Olympic-sized pool, a waterslide area, a warm water lap pool & spa, and a family splash zone complete with a lazy river – all in one huge room.

It’s important to note that different water features are available at different times – not all features are always available.

Splash Zone at Holland Aquatic Center

The Splash Zone is where most families head when visiting the Holland Aquatic Center.

This is where you’ll find the zero-entry wading pool, lazy river, waterslide, cannon sprayers, play area, and more.

Note: Kids under 42 inches tall must have an adult in the water with them. Children who are not toilet trained must wear a swim diaper.

Swim Diapers

Kids that aren’t potty-trained are required to wear a swim diaper or a cloth diaper with tight-fitting rubber pants.
Bring your own or purchase a disposable swim diaper ($2 each) at the front desk.

Life Jackets

Visitors that aren’t strong swimmers will need to wear a US Coast Guard-approved life jacket in certain parts of the aquatic center.
You may bring your own from home or rent one at the front desk.

Wading Pool & Water Playground

Tumble buckets, a spinning water wheel, and splashing fun!  This area is especially fun for preschool-age children with their parents.
It features a zero-depth entry pool, so swimming here is just like visiting a lake.

This section is open during all Splash times including Preschool Swim, Adaptive Splash, Homeschool Splash, Family Splash hours – see their schedule for details.

150-Foot Water Slide

Three stories high with a triple-spiral!
You must be 48 inches tall to go on this water slide.
It’s open during all regular Splash Zone hours except Preschool Splash.

Holland Aquatic Center Waterslide

Lazy River

Kids love going for a “spin” in the lazy river!
Available during Splash Zone hours except Preschool Splash.

Water Fun for Older Kids & Adults

AquaTrack

AquaTrack is a 2-person, gigantic, floating obstacle course. Swim test required for access.
The AquaTrack is available during weekend open swim times on Saturdays and Sundays.

Holland Aquatic Center

Alpine Challenge Rock Wall

Alpine Rock Wall is a 12ft inflatable iceberg. Climb if you dare!

Offered during Mega Family Splash only.

Holland Aquatic Center

Zip Line

Fly across the pool on the popular zipline. In order to use this feature, you must be able to reach the handle without assistance.
Swimmers must pass a swim test to use the zip line.
The zip line is available during Super Splash and Mega Splash .

Whirlpool Spa

The spa is available for adults (age 16+).
The spa is open during all listed lap swim hours.

Locker Rooms, Towels & Amenities

Lockers


There are two different types of locker rooms at the Holland Aquatic Center.

There’s a traditional single-gender men’s and women’s locker room complete with lockers, restrooms and showers. These locker rooms are connected to the 50-meter competitive pool deck and not far from the other amenities and pools.

There is also a Universal Change Room on the East side of the building. The change room provides inclusivity and accessibility for all guests; it’s a great place for families with children who may require more help getting changed. Private cubicles and shower rooms that allow guests to change in private.

There are also open showers that require guests to remain in their swimsuit. Guests are required to remain clothed unless they are in a private shower stall, restroom stall or private cubicle.

Holland Aquatic Center Locker Rooms

Towels

Bring your own towels or rent them for $2 each at the front desk.
